WebSBA’s Office of Credit Risk Management (OCRM) is updating its oversight of SBA Supervised Lenders. This revised Risk-Based Review (“Review”) and Safety and Soundness Examination (“Examination”) protocol is applicable to SBA Supervised Lenders, and is intended to be … WebThe Small Business Administration’s (SBA) Office of Credit Risk Management (OCRM) oversees a multi-billion-dollar 7(a) loan portfolio that represents its largest and most popular loan program. Managing credit risk of the 7(a) Loan Program is of paramount importance to OCRM, which is charged with minimizing risk and financial loss to SBA. ...

WebFeb 8, 2024 · The SBA Office of Credit Risk Management (“OCRM”), conducts continuous, risk-based lender oversight on all SBA lenders and CDCs. WebSBA’s reviews for lender compliance on defaulted loans were generally effective. However, opportunities exist to strengthen to controls further mitigate riskthe of loss for loans sold on the secondary market. WebFeb 16, 2024 · The Risk Rating System is an internal tool that uses data in SBA's Loan and Lender Monitoring System (L/LMS), borrower data provided by Dun & Bradstreet (D&B), and certain macroeconomic factors to assist SBA in assessing the risk of the SBA loan …
